Areas in London where Somalis live

Keo

VIP
City of Westminster: Maida Vale (W9)

Kensington & Chelsea: Ladbroke Grove (W10/W11)

Hammersmith and Fulham: Shepherd's Bush (W12), White City (W12), Fulham (SW6)

Wandsworth: Roehampton (SW15), Putney (SW15), Tooting (SW17)

Lambeth: Streatham (SW16)

Tower Hamlets: Bethnal Green (E1/E2), Mile End (E3)

Islington: Islington (N1), Tufnell Park (N7/N19), Holloway (N7)

Camden: Camden Town (NW1), Kentish Town (NW5)

Brent: Harlesden (NW10), Neasden (NW10), Queen's Park (W9/W10)

Ealing: West Ealing (W13), Acton (W3), Greenford (UB6), Northolt (UB5), Southall (UB1/UB2)

Hounslow: Isleworth (TW7), Brentford (TW8)

Greenwich: Woolwich (SE18)

Redbridge: Ilford (IG1/IG2), Newbury Park (IG2), Seven Kings (IG3)

Newham: Upton Park (E6), Manor Park (E12)

Waltham Forest: Leyton (E10), Leytonstone (E11), Walthamstow (E17)

Haringey: Wood Green (N22), Turnpike Lane (N8/N22), Hornsey (N8), Edmonton (N9)

Enfield: Enfield Town (EN1/EN2), Enfield Highway/Lock (EN3), Arnos Grove (N11/N14)

Barnet: Finchley (N2/N3/N12), Colindale (NW9)

Harrow: Harrow on the Hill (HA1), South Harrow (HA2), Harrow Weald (HA3), Wealdstone (HA3)

Hillingdon: Hayes Town (UB3)

There are Somalis in every borough tho according to the census data, the three with the most are Brent, Ealing and Enfield in that order. Those three combined have 11.6k + 9.4k + 7.9k ≈ 29 thousand ppl.

Incidentally, Birmingham, which is home to the second largest Somali population after London, has around 20 thousand which puts into perspective the fact that 62% of all Somalis in England and Wales live in the capital.
